基于CANopen协议实现TX90机器人外部轴通信
以史陶比尔(Stäubli)TX90六轴工业机器人为例,介绍CANopen通信协议中过程数据对象的通信过程。在机器人控制器不具有电子数据文档导入功能的情况下,针对机器人主站对象字典未按照DSP402设备子协议设置对象0x6060长度的问题,提出一种在外部轴驱动器对象字典中增加对象的方法。拆分机器人控制器发送的16位数据,将低8位数据存储在外部轴驱动器对象0x6060中,高8位数据存储在0x607E中。在不丢失机器人发送数据的前提下,完成外部轴驱动器与机器人控制器的组网,实现外部轴与机器人本体六轴同步运动。
-
共1页/1条